I had a mixed experience at this hotel. While the location was charming and a short drive from the Baseball Hall of Fame, my room left a lot to be desired in terms of comfort and upkeep. The staff had their moments, but overall, I felt there were significant service issues that could easily be improved. Dining was also not up to par as there were no breakfast options available, which was disappointing.
Staying here was an experience I won't forget, but not for the right reasons. While I was grateful to have a roof over my head for a brief night, the overall condition of the hotel and lack of staff made for a rough stay. The location is close to Cooperstown, which is a plus, but the state of the place left much to be desired. For the price, I expected a lot more comfort and cleanliness.
This hotel has a unique charm and is set in a lovely location right by a large lake, perfect for outdoor activities like ice fishing. However, my room did not meet my expectations, especially after paying extra for a 'lake view.' The service leaves much to be desired, and the absence of breakfast options was disappointing. Despite the friendly staff, the hotel's condition and cleanliness could use improvement.
